Dotty's Vintage Tearoom
Sink into a cozy afternoon at Dotty's Vintage Tearoom, nestled in the charming village of Saltburn-by-the-Sea, England. This quaint tearoom delights travel lovers with its nostalgic atmosphere, vintage china, and hearty homemade treats like scones with clotted cream and jam, delicate sliced cheese, and fresh sandwiches. The warm hospitality and softly lit interior invite you to slow down, savor traditional English tea culture, and share intimate moments with friends or loved ones. The nearest airport is Durham Tees Valley Airport (MME), approximately 50 minutes by car from Saltburn-by-the-Sea.
Stay in nearby cozy seaside inns, traditional English bed & breakfasts, or charming boutique guesthouses within Saltburn-by-the-Sea.
Explore the picturesque Saltburn Pier, scenic coastal walks along the Cleveland Way, or visit the Saltburn Cliff Lift for panoramic views.
